Akufo-Addo Uses The Smallest Convoy In Ghana’s History – Pius Enam Hadzide

President Akufo-Addo is the only president in Ghana’s history to employ a small convoy, according to former Deputy Information Minister and CEO of Youth Employment Authority (YEA), Pius Enam Hadzide.

In the Wednesday, January 12, 2022, episode of the show, Johnny Hudges, the host of TV3’s Newday program, advised that the president should lower the size of his convoy to save money for the government.

When debating with his panelists a remark made by Hon. Patrick Yaw Boamah, MP for Okaikwei Central, that government spending must be decreased in order to justify the imposition of higher taxes, Johnny Hudges offered the recommendation.

In response to Johnny Hudge’s claims, the NYA chairman claimed that the president travels in the smallest convoy in Ghana’s history.

He explained that the president’s convoy looks to be long because more dignitaries join the convoy anytime he [the president] is on the move.

“The president’s Convoy isn’t going to be lengthy.” His Convoy is the shortest in our history; he stated.
